Surfboard Essentials: Boards, Suits & More

Hitting the waves for the first time can be a intimidating experience. But don't worry, we've got you covered with a list of essential equipment. First up, you need a board that suits your abilities. Beginners often start with a longer, wider soft-top board for stability. As you progress, you can explore skimmers for more radical moves.

Next, consider the water temperature. A rash guard will keep you warm and comfortable in colder waters. Don't forget the {wax! It provides grip on your board so you can balance confidently.

Other essentials include a safety cord to keep your board attached, a tool for repairs, and a protector.
